Step 1
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Step 2
In a large bowl, mix the cooked rice with red curry paste, oil, and salt until well combined.
Step 3
Spread the rice mixture evenly on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
Step 4
Bake for 20-25 minutes, stirring halfway through, until the rice becomes crispy and golden.
Step 5
Remove from the oven and let it cool slightly.
Step 6
Prepare the Salad:
Step 7
In a large bowl, combine the cucumber, cilantro, mint, shallots/onions, chili (if using), and crushed peanuts.
Step 8
In a small bowl, whisk together the ginger, garlic, soy sauce, lemon juice, brown sugar, oil, and chili crisp (if using).
Step 9
If the dressing is too thick, add 1-2 tablespoons of water to thin it out to your desired consistency.
Step 10
Add the crispy rice to the salad bowl with the vegetables and peanuts.
Step 11
Pour the dressing over the salad and toss well to combine.
Step 12
Serve immediately and enjoy!
